Vendor note for security review: the Marlowe Hall box office uses SeatScape, a seat-map renderer licensed from Quillbrook Systems. The renderer runs client-side and fetches venue layouts from our own API; no patron data flows to the vendor. Quillbrook's last penetration test summary was shared under NDA and is filed with the procurement packet. Their SDK is pinned to a reviewed version and updated quarterly. For questions on the vendor's security posture, reach their assurance desk directly.

escalation mailbox, bafog-fafog: ulador@paliqlabs.internal

**Q: How do I regain access to the Quillpress invoice renderer when my session expires mid-batch?**

A: The renderer locks its template store after thirty idle minutes to protect draft invoices. Interrupted batches resume automatically once you re-authenticate, so nothing is lost. New contractors do not yet have personal recovery keys, so use the shared recovery flow instead. The shared recovery passphrase you will need is below.

strongbox words: zorwyn-sorael-belion-ulaius-silmir-ulays-briax-rusdor-gorix

Key ceremony checklist — item 7 (plugin authors, read this!)

Before signing, regenerate the static-analysis baseline file for your Brickloom plugin and commit it — the ceremony tooling refuses unsigned diffs against a stale baseline. Yes, even for one-line fixes. Takes about a minute. Once the baseline is fresh, unlock the signing enclave with the passphrase shown below.

unlock words, hahip-baduf: holwyn-istath-julvan